    I've received couple of hours ago this email from google

    While going through our records recently, we found that your AdSense
    account has posed a significant risk to our AdWords advertisers. Since
    keeping your account in our publisher network may financially damage
    our advertisers in the future, we've decided to disable your account.
    
    Please understand that we consider this a necessary step to protect the
    interests of both our advertisers and our other AdSense publishers. We
    realize the inconvenience this may cause you, and we thank you in
    advance for your understanding and cooperation.
    Code (markup):
    have anyone else received this email? what should I do? Should I make an appeal?
    I wasn't making lots of money like they sad. 10-13$/day on 0.8-1.2% CTR
